What Does a a Truck Insurance Agent in High Point Cost?
Typical annual premiums for truck insurance in North Carolina range from $8,000 to $15,000 for basic liability coverage on a single truck. Full coverage with cargo and physical damage can cost $12,000 to $25,000 per year. Rates vary by driver experience, vehicle age, and coverage limits.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the minimum insurance requirements for a truck in High Point North Carolina?
North Carolina requires commercial trucks to have at least $30,000 in bodily injury liability per person and $60,000 per accident. For property damage, the minimum is $25,000. Higher limits are often needed for interstate hauling.
How do I find a truck insurance agent in High Point North Carolina?
You can search online directories or contact the North Carolina Department of Insurance for a list of licensed agents. Local trucking associations in the Piedmont Triad area can also provide referrals.
What factors affect truck insurance costs in High Point North Carolina?
Costs depend on driving history, truck type, cargo value, and annual mileage. North Carolina rates are also influenced by local accident statistics and weather patterns in the Piedmont region.
